Bill Text: MN HF1504 | 2013-2014 | 88th Legislature | Introduced


Bill Title: Minnesota Legislature members continuing education requirements established.

Spectrum: Partisan Bill (Republican 1-0)

Status: (Introduced - Dead) 2013-03-13 - Introduction and first reading, referred to Government Operations [HF1504 Detail]

1.1A bill for an act
1.2relating to the Minnesota Legislature; establishing continuing education
1.3requirements for members;proposing coding for new law in Minnesota Statutes,
1.4chapter 3.
1.5B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F MINNESOTA:

1.6    Section 1. [3.084] CONTINUING EDUCATION REQUIREMENTS; MEMBERS.
1.7    Subdivision 1. Education. Every member of the Minnesota Legislature will
1.8complete a minimum of 12 hours of continuing education each biennium, in a series of
1.9courses on the Minnesota Constitution, the United States Constitution, and United States
1.10and world history.
1.11    Subd. 2. Legislative Coordinating Commission; duties. The Legislative
1.12Coordinating Commission shall adopt policies and procedures necessary to implement
1.13the continuing education requirements of this section and shall publish and provide
1.14opportunities for all members to meet these requirements during the normal course
1.15of legislative business. No additional per diem payments, other than those allowed
1.16under current operating standards, will be provided to members for completion of these
1.17education requirements. The commission may issue requests for proposals or take any
1.18other actions necessary to provide education required under this section.
1.19EFFECTIVE DATE.This section is effective the day following final enactment.
1.20The continuing education requirement for the remainder of the current biennium shall
1.21be six credits.
